The innovative Liquid Caddy is the first and only gimbaled and adjustable beverage holder that enables your favorite beverage to stay upright all day. Just pull and twist the bottom of the Liquid Caddy and it will increase in height while at the same time automatically adjusting its inner diameter. Quickly attaches virtually anywhere. Includes a Velcro® brand extension, suction cup mount and a clip mount.
